
Introduction
The modern software landscape is defined by velocity and resilience, where the ability to ship code safely is the ultimate competitive advantage. For engineers and architects, the challenge lies in mastering an ever-expanding stack of tools—from container orchestration and automated security to cloud-native observability—that make this speed possible. While the theoretical concepts of DevOps, SRE, and GitOps are widely discussed, true professional growth demands a structured, validated approach to these disciplines. This guide cuts through the noise of the crowded certification market, providing a clear, actionable roadmap to selecting the right credentials that will not only sharpen your technical edge but also accelerate your career trajectory in the world of high-scale automation.
What is a DevOps Certification?
A Best DevOps certification serves as a formal validation of your expertise in bridging the gap between software development and IT operations. It goes beyond theoretical knowledge, testing your ability to implement CI/CD pipelines, manage container orchestration, automate infrastructure provisioning, and ensure continuous monitoring. These programs provide a structured learning path that transforms practitioners into proficient engineers capable of optimizing the Software Development Life Cycle (SDLC) for speed, efficiency, and reliability.
Why DevOps Certifications Matter
Certifications act as a critical differentiator in a competitive job market. They provide a clear framework for professional growth, ensuring you are equipped with standardized best practices rather than relying on fragmented, self-taught methods.
The Step-by-Step Value of Certification:
- Foundational Mastery: Establishes a baseline understanding of core DevOps principles (Culture, Automation, Measurement, Sharing).
- Vendor-Specific Expertise: Validates your proficiency in specific ecosystem tools (AWS, Azure, Google Cloud).
- Credentialing: Provides an industry-recognized signal to employers that you have passed rigorous hands-on assessments.
- Networking & Community: Connects you with global communities of certified professionals for ongoing learning and support.
Who Should Take DevOps Certifications?
Whether you are starting from scratch or looking to specialize in emerging fields like MLOps or GitOps, certifications offer a pathway for diverse roles:
- Students & Freshers: Building an initial career foundation in modern IT operations.
- Software & QA Engineers: Transitioning into automation and pipeline management.
- System Administrators: Evolving into Cloud or Platform Engineering roles.
- Cloud & SRE Professionals: Validating advanced skills in reliability, scaling, and observability.
- IT Managers: Understanding the technical shifts required to lead modern, agile teams.
Core Skills Covered
Professional DevOps certification programs generally emphasize a blend of technical and process-oriented competencies:
- CI/CD Pipeline Automation: Automating the build, test, and deployment phases.
- Infrastructure as Code (IaC): Managing and provisioning infrastructure through machine-readable definition files.
- Containerization & Orchestration: Packaging applications and managing deployments at scale.
- Cloud Computing: Leveraging service providers for scalable and resilient architecture.
- Security & Compliance: Integrating security protocols directly into the development pipeline.
- Observability & Monitoring: Gaining actionable insights into system performance and health.
Table 1: Best DevOps Certifications
| Certification Name | Best For | Skill Level | Career Direction |
| DevOps Certified Professional (DCP) | Foundations | Beginner | DevOps Engineer |
| DevSecOps Certified Professional (DSOCP) | Security Focus | Intermediate | DevSecOps Engineer |
| Site Reliability Engineering (SRE) Certified Professional | System Stability | Intermediate | SRE |
| Master in DevOps Engineering (MDE) | Mastery | Advanced | Lead DevOps Engineer |
| Master in Azure DevOps | Azure Cloud | Intermediate | Cloud Architect |
| AWS Certified DevOps Professional | AWS Cloud | Advanced | DevOps Architect |
| Master in Python Programming | Scripting | Beginner | Automation Engineer |
| Hashicorp Certified Terraform Associate | IaC | Intermediate | Platform Engineer |
| Certified Kubernetes Administrator (CKA) | Orchestration | Advanced | K8s Specialist |
| Docker Certified Associate (DCA) | Containerization | Intermediate | Cloud Engineer |
| Envoy ISTIO Certification Training | Service Mesh | Advanced | Network/Cloud Engineer |
| MLOps Certification Training Course | AI/ML Pipelines | Advanced | MLOps Engineer |
| Google Cloud Professional Cloud DevOps Engineer | GCP Cloud | Advanced | Cloud Engineer |
| Master in Machine Learning | AI Integration | Advanced | ML Engineer |
| Master in Artificial Intelligence | AI Automation | Advanced | AI Engineer |
| Master in AppDynamics | Monitoring | Intermediate | Observability Engineer |
| Master in Data Science | Big Data | Intermediate | Data Engineer |
| Master in Deep Learning | Advanced AI | Advanced | AI Research |
| Prometheus with Grafana | Observability | Intermediate | SRE/DevOps |
| GitOps Certified Professional (GOCP) | Git-based Ops | Intermediate | GitOps Engineer |
Certification Deep Dive
- Real-World Use Case: Implementing a self-healing CI/CD pipeline that automatically detects code vulnerabilities and deploys to Kubernetes clusters without manual intervention.
- Skills You Will Learn: Proficiency in IaC (Terraform), container orchestration (Kubernetes), pipeline orchestration (Jenkins/GitHub Actions), and proactive monitoring (Prometheus/Grafana).
- Career Scope: Roles such as DevOps Engineer, Cloud Architect, SRE, Platform Engineer, and Security Consultant.
- Difficulty Level: Varies from foundational (entry-level) to highly technical/advanced.
- Best Career Fit: Professionals looking to shift into automation, cloud architecture, or site reliability.
- Who Should Take It: Software engineers, sysadmins, and IT leads aiming to standardize their skill set.
- Hands-On Projects: Building a production-grade CI/CD pipeline, configuring multi-node Kubernetes clusters, and establishing automated security testing.
DevOps Certification Roadmap
| Career Goal | Recommended Path | Why It Fits |
| Cloud Generalist | AWS/Azure/GCP DevOps Certs | Deeply integrated into major cloud platforms. |
| Site Reliability (SRE) | SRE + Kubernetes + Prometheus | Focuses on reliability, SLIs/SLOs, and monitoring. |
| DevSecOps Engineer | DevSecOps + CKA | Blends operational speed with rigorous security. |
| AI/ML Specialist | MLOps + Python + Master in ML | Bridges the gap between ML models and delivery. |
Common Mistakes to Avoid
- Chasing certificates over experience: Do not collect certifications without building actual projects.
- Ignoring the fundamentals: Skipping Linux/Scripting to jump straight into complex tools.
- Tunnel vision: Focusing only on one cloud provider without understanding platform-agnostic tools.
- Neglecting Hands-on Lab work: Relying purely on theory while ignoring the terminal.
Real-Life Examples
- A Junior SysAdmin uses a DevOps certification to transition into a Cloud Engineer role, resulting in a 40% salary increase.
- A software team reduces production deployment time from days to minutes by implementing skills learned in a GitOps certification course.
- An SRE uses advanced monitoring training to resolve a persistent, intermittent memory leak in a high-traffic production application.
- A security analyst pivots to DevSecOps, successfully reducing critical vulnerability detection time by implementing automated security scanning.
- A data engineer bridges the gap between data modeling and deployment by obtaining an MLOps certification to automate model training.
FAQs
- Which certification is best for beginners? The DevOps Certified Professional (DCP) is the ideal starting point to build a strong foundation.
- How long does it take to get certified? Depending on the intensity and your existing knowledge, 2–6 months is standard.
- Are DevOps certifications valid for a lifetime? Most are valid for 2–3 years, requiring renewal as technology evolves.
- Do I need coding skills? Yes, basic scripting (Python/Bash) is essential for effective automation.
- Is CKA difficult? It is a performance-based exam that requires deep hands-on practice, making it moderately difficult but highly rewarding.
- Which cloud certification is best? Choose based on your employer’s stack (AWS, Azure, or GCP).
- What is the difference between DevOps and SRE? DevOps is a culture/methodology; SRE is a specific engineering implementation of that culture.
- Can I start with MLOps? It is recommended to understand basic DevOps principles first for a smoother learning curve.
- Do I need to be a developer? No, but understanding development workflows is a significant advantage.
- How do I practice for these? Use dedicated lab environments, cloud free-tiers, and local virtual machines.
- Will certification guarantee a job? It boosts your profile, but consistent projects and interview preparation are key.
- What if I have no experience? Start with foundations, join local meetups, and build a portfolio on GitHub.
Conclusion
Achieving mastery in the DevOps ecosystem is a journey of continuous refinement, where each certification acts as a milestone rather than a final destination. By aligning your learning path with real-world industry demands—such as Kubernetes orchestration, automated security integration, and data-driven observability—you transform from a tool user into a strategic engineer who can solve complex architectural problems. The key to long-term success lies in the synthesis of these formal credentials with consistent, hands-on lab experimentation. Use the structured paths outlined in this guide to prioritize your development, build a robust project portfolio, and position yourself at the forefront of the industry.